Ingredients:
- six medium potatoes
- four to five tablespoons of cornstarch
- salt to taste
- oil for frying

Instructions:
Step 1:
Place the potatoes in a big pot and fill it with water. Boil the potatoes until they are soft. Peel the skin off and place them in a bowl. Mash them using a fork or a potato masher.
Step 2:
Add some salt to the mashed potatoes and mix until well incorporated.
Step 3:
Gradually add 4 to 5 tablespoons of cornstarch to the mashed potato and mix after every addition.
Step 4:
Transfer the potato to your work surface and roll it. Divide it into four parts. Get one and roll it. Cut it again into small pieces, then roll each into a ball. Try to make them in the same size as much as possible.
Step 5:
Get a hand juicer and brush it with oil. Flatten one of the balls and press it onto the tip of the juicer to form a clam shape. Repeat with the remaining dough balls.
Step 6:
Add a generous amount of oil into a pan and place over heat. Once hot, add the formed potatoes and fry until golden brown on all sides.
Step 7:
Once done, strain them and place them over a plate lined with a paper towel to remove excess oil. Serve it with your favorite sauce and enjoy!
